Bill got bored with the usual Sportsman figures, and threw in an inverted spin and a vertical roll into his Freestyle flight. I've never seen that before in Sportsman. All scored well. Nice flying Bill!
 
Hopefully Bill does not ind me sharing his freestyle!

I dare any other Sportsman guys to use it! :D I probably shouldn't say this, but inverted spins actually give you better visibility of the ground under your rotational axis, which many feel makes orientation easier....ONCE you get used to the different sensation, inputs, and inverted sight picture. They just take some adjusting to. Full credit to Bill for taking the challenge above and beyond the minimum requirements of Sportsman. Heck, some would say he's just showing off...sandbagger. :D
